Allura Red AC is a food azo dye used in the food, pharmaceutical, paper, cosmetic and textile industries. Synonyms: Allura Red; Food Red No.40; 6-Hydroxy-5-[2-(2-methoxy-5-methyl-4-sulfophenyl)diazenyl]-2-naphthalenesulfonic Acid Sodium Salt; 6-Hydroxy-5-[(6-methoxy-4-sulfo-m-tolyl)azo]-2-naphthalenesulfonic Acid Disodium Salt; Allura Red 40; FDC Red 40 dye; Fancy Red; Food Red 17. Grades: >95%. CAS No. 25956-17-6. Molecular formula: C18H14N2Na2O8S2. Mole weight: 496.42.
Allura Red AC
Allura Red AC is a food colorant, appearing as a deep red water-soluble powder or granules, used in various applications such as beverages, syrups, candies, and cereals. Allura Red AC can statically quench the intrinsic fluorescence of HSA. Additionally, Allura Red AC is a 5-hydroxytryptamine ( 5-HT ) pathway-associated pro-inflammatory agent, capable of exacerbating experimental colitis. Allura Red AC holds potential for research in inflammatory bowel disease (IBD), intestinal barrier function, and food additive safety [1] [2] [3]. Uses: Scientific research. Group: Fluorescent dye.
